| will it be possible to run the quantian linux version with another kernel
| for an x64 machine? Or will I experience problems because programs won’t
| work at that machine?

Quantian only works in 32bit mode.  

So you could boot your machine with the Quantian dvd (and run in 32bit
mode). Or you could try to use an emulator like vmware to run a 32bit guest
session with Quantian inside of a 64bit (linux, I suppose) host.
